新聞中心
要將JSP轉(zhuǎn)換為HTML代碼,可以使用JSP編譯器或在線轉(zhuǎn)換工具。這些工具會將JSP文件中的Java代碼和JSP標簽轉(zhuǎn)換為對應的HTML標記和JavaScript代碼。
JSP轉(zhuǎn)換為HTML代碼

JSP(JavaServer Pages)是一種動態(tài)網(wǎng)頁技術(shù),它允許在HTML代碼中嵌入Java代碼片段,從而實現(xiàn)動態(tài)內(nèi)容的生成,要將JSP轉(zhuǎn)換為HTML代碼,需要經(jīng)過以下幾個步驟:
1. 編寫JSP文件
創(chuàng)建一個JSP文件,例如example.jsp,并在其中編寫HTML代碼和Java代碼,以下是一個簡單的示例:
<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%>
JSP to HTML Example
Hello, <%= request.getParameter("name") %>
在這個示例中,我們使用<%= ... %>標簽嵌入了一個Java表達式,用于獲取請求參數(shù)name的值,并將其顯示在頁面上。
2. 部署到服務器
將JSP文件部署到支持JSP的Web服務器上,例如Tomcat,部署完成后,通過瀏覽器訪問JSP文件的URL,例如http://localhost:8080/example.jsp?name=John。
3. JSP編譯過程
當?shù)谝淮卧L問JSP文件時,Web服務器會對JSP文件進行編譯,將其轉(zhuǎn)換為一個Servlet類,這個過程通常由服務器自動完成,不需要手動干預。
4. 生成HTML代碼
編譯完成后,Web服務器會執(zhí)行生成的Servlet類,并將結(jié)果作為HTML代碼返回給瀏覽器,瀏覽器接收到HTML代碼后,解析并顯示頁面內(nèi)容。
相關(guān)問題與解答
Q1: JSP文件是如何被編譯的?
A1: JSP文件在第一次被訪問時,會被Web服務器編譯成一個Servlet類,這個過程中,JSP文件中的靜態(tài)內(nèi)容(如HTML標簽和文本)會被保留,而動態(tài)內(nèi)容(如Java代碼片段)會被轉(zhuǎn)換為Servlet類的Java代碼,編譯完成后,Servlet類會被加載到內(nèi)存中,等待執(zhí)行。
Q2: 如果我想直接查看生成的HTML代碼,而不通過瀏覽器訪問,該怎么辦?
A2: 你可以直接在Web服務器的工作目錄下查找生成的HTML文件,以Tomcat為例,你可以在Tomcat/work目錄下找到對應的臨時文件夾,其中包含了編譯后的JSP文件,請注意,這些文件可能會被定期清理,因此建議在查看之前備份一份。
新聞標題:jsp如何轉(zhuǎn)換為html代碼
URL標題:http://m.fisionsoft.com.cn/article/cdhphgg.html


咨詢
建站咨詢
